Здравствуйте! прошу помощи в решении следующего вопроса (Thunderbird 2.0.0.6):
периодически возникает необходимость в отправке файлов большого объема. Такие файлы разбиваются мной на куски по 4-5 мБ и отсылаются поочередно. Но это же нудно, каждый раз составлять новое сообщение, писать тот же адрес .
Нельзя ли сказать почтарю, что "вот тебе пачка файлов, отправь их Сидорову или Иванову поочередно (одно отправилось - шли второе), вот с таким вот сообщением в теле письма".
собственно всё. Есть соображения?
Отредактировано Папа Серёжа (08-10-2007 11:40:10)
Отсутствует
1.
Отправка множественных вложений из файлов архива:
@echo off
FOR %%i IN (c:\rars\*.rar) DO thunderbird.exe -compose "to=foo@nowhere.net,subject=Archives,body=Hello!,attachment='%%i'"
2.
BLAT - консольный инструмент для отправки сообщений
[http://peterhost.dl.sourceforge.net/sourceforge/blat/Blat250.zip]
При первом запуске этой программы необходимо зарегистрировать для нее адрес, порт, имя и пароль Вашей учетной записи, которую Вы будете использовать для отправки - в документации все подробно описано. То есть настроить ее для работы с Вашим SMTP или иным сервером.
Код-пример:
blat.exe ФайлСТекстомПисьма -tf ФайлСАдресатами -attach ФайлПриложенияКПисьму -subject ТемаПисьма
Код-пример:
C:\Bin\blat.exe E:\Alex\Config\dsp.txt -tf e:\alex\address.txt -attach "c:\bin\ostatkiDSP.rar" -subject "OSTATKI DSP"
Код-пример:
for %%a in (*.*) do blat.exe ФайлСТекстомПисьма -tf ФайлСАдресатами -attach %%a -subject ТемаПисьма
3.
создать скрипт (под свои потаенные желания), в качестве отправной точки:
How to send HTML formatted mail using CDO for Windows 2000 and a remote SMTP service
(http://support.microsoft.com/kb/286431)
Отсутствует
@echo off
FOR %%i IN (c:\rars\*.rar) DO thunderbird.exe -compose "to=foo@nowhere.net,subject=Archives,body=Hello!,attachment='%%i'"
если я Вас правильно понял, делается батник с такой вот строчкой, прописываются адреса, путь к TB и аля улю?
Отсутствует
если я Вас правильно понял, делается батник с такой вот строчкой ....
да. но это следует рассматривать лишь как наброски. в пакетный (командный) файл можно положить много чего интересного в плане облегчения себе жизни при работе с "толстыми" письмами.
однако, на мой взгляд, сценарий (по вар.3) дает большую свободу действий.
пусть компьютер сам сам сжимает файл, режет на части, отправляет, ведет лог ошибок ...
Отсутствует
нашёл более простой вариант, к сожалению не связанный с TB, которым пользуюсь уже много лет. Нашлась фриварная прога ManyMail , которая решила все проблемы, и заточена именно для отправки больших файлищ через SMTP. Хотя сам склоняюсь к варианту №2, как наиболее функциональному.
да, ссылка на эту тему программа для рассылки пакетов
Отредактировано Папа Серёжа (10-10-2007 18:06:41)
Отсутствует